He worked with the director David Lean on four films that spanned Savage's entire career.
Lean has been noted as possibly "the best British film director ever", and was himself a masterful editor.
[1] Savage started his career as an assistant editor on Lean's Hobson's Choice (1954).
Savage was Anne V. Coates' first assistant editor for Lean's Lawrence of Arabia (1962).
[2] Savage died of leukemia while editing the film Lady Caroline Lamb (1972).
